HEALTH PROGRAM
Health Program
latest update: September 2009

SDC supports several projects in the health domain in Tajikistan. Although separately administered, the projects complement each other by coherently assisting the Ministry of Health in the implementation of the  health sector reform. 
 


160 Launched in 2003, the Health Care Reform and Family Medicine Support Project helps the Ministry of Health to develop, test and implement a new primary health care model in four pilot districts – Varzob, Dangara, Tursunzade and Shahrinaw.




Strengthening Health Research Capacities in Support of Health Sector Reform Tajikistan  Together with a number of other donors, SDC is supporting preparatory works for the introduction of a Sector Wide Approach (SWAp) in the Tajik Health Sector. For coordination work and technical assistance, SDC has allocated so far around 450’000 US Dollars.

 


Health Policy Dialogue ProjectUndergraduate medical education at the Tajik State Medical University is undergoing reforms. SDC supports this process by providing technical and financial assistance to a working group that has been established to elaborate a detailed reform concept.

Students at the Tajik State Medical University face a drastic shortage of books, making it difficult to learn and prepare for exams. As a contribution to the Library of the Tajik Medical University SDC provided funds for the purchase of over 5000 new basic educational books, thereby making a small but important contribution to higher quality in medical education.


Community and Basic Health Project The Community and Basic Health Project co-funded by Worldbank, SIDA and SDC covers a wide range of health topics from Primary Health Care to Health Sector Coordination. Participation in this project will allow SDC to both gain experiences for its other ongoing health projects and to disseminate knowledge gained there in.



In total Swiss contribution to the health sector in Tajikistan currently amounts to more than six million US dollars.
